WebJun 2, 2024 · Prevention and Treatment of PAD Treatment for peripheral artery disease focuses on reducing symptoms and preventing further progression of the condition. In most cases, lifestyle changes, exercise and claudication medications are enough to slow the progression or even reverse the symptoms of PAD. WebPeripheral Arterial Disease (PAD) is a condition that affects the circulation of blood in the legs and feet. It occurs when there is a buildup of plaque in the arteries that supply blood to the lower extremities, causing reduced blood flow and oxygen to the muscles and tissues. PAD can cause a range of symptoms, including pain, cramping, and ...
